While earning their accredited Master of Business Administration degree, students will take in new information, tools, and hands-on learning experiences that will empower their for the future. The program emphasizes:

  • Competence (building your skills)
  • Character (establishing a moral and ethical framework for decision-making)
  • Compassion (instilling in our graduates the virtue of loving your neighbor)
  • Leadership (an informed Christian ideal of servanthood)

Students can take the general track for a 37-hour credit program, or you can add a track with a concentration and complete their MBA as a 41-hour credit curriculum. Either way, student can complete both options in less than two years.
